Lucknow, September 11: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Mayawati today directed the officials of state health department to take “pre-emptive” measures to check the spread of contagious diseases due to flood-like situation in several districts of the state.
According to the official release, issued here after a review meeting of the health department, the Chief Minister asked officials to initiate measures to check the spread of infectious diseases caused due to contamination of water and set up teams of doctors equipped with required medicines and equipments to effectively deal with any such eventuality.
She stressed that in case of an outbreak of communicable diseases, the concerned Chief Medical Officers (CMOs) would be held responsible.
She said her government was committed to provide quality medical services to the people through government hospitals.
